Obituary of Irene Wuschke

Irene Helen Wuschke was born in the Mazenod district on August 11, 1931, and passed peacefully to be with Jesus on October 2, 2025, at the Chateau St. Michael in Moose Jaw, SK, at the age of 94, surrounded by the love of her family.

Our beloved Irene was the matriarch of our family and beyond. As paraphrased in Colossians 3:12, Irene was truly “clothed with compassion, kindness, humility, a gentle wisdom, and a loving patience,” reflecting the attributes of her strong Christian faith.

She grew up on the farm south of Courval, SK. Irene met her husband Paul in 1948 at the movie theatre in Mossbank. They were married on June 12, 1949, and lived on the family farm in the Mossbank area until 1984, after which they moved into town. They were blessed with three children: Sharon, Lorna, and Darrell. Together, they farmed side by side, and harvest was one of Irene’s favourite times of the year. She especially enjoyed driving the combine.

Irene was a wonderful cook, and many delicious meals were shared with cousins who came to visit for a few days. She loved tending to her large gardens, canning the fruits of her labour, and making pickles — one of her favourite activities.

In 2011, Paul passed away at the age of 94. Irene eventually moved from her house and lived in Sask Housing in Mossbank until December 2022. She then moved into Mulberry Estates in Moose Jaw in January 2023, where she lived until September 18 of this year. Irene spent her final two weeks at Chateau St. Michael’s.

Irene was very involved in the community and had a deep admiration for the town of Mossbank. She took an interest in families in and around the area and fostered warm relationships within the community. She was active in the Royal Purple, Hospital Auxiliary, Quirky Quilting Club, 50+ Club, and always participated in Trinity Lutheran Church activities and the ELW prayer group. She also enjoyed “Coffee Row” with the ladies at “The Bent Nail Café”

Irene loved socializing, and we all have fond memories of those memorable Wuschke/Stark/Sawin gatherings, “meals, music, laughter, and kids in every corner of the house.”
